Job Description - Leasing Specialist

Make an impact

We are looking for a Leasing Specialist who is passionate about providing excellent customer service, achieving leasing goals, and maintaining high occupancy levels across our properties. The Leasing Specialist will play a key role in marketing, leasing, and resident retention efforts within the market. This role requires a strong sales mindset, excellent communication skills, and the ability to build strong customer relationships.

  • Maintain a 70–75% closing ratio while providing an exceptional leasing experience.

  • Utilize strong phone communication skills to pre-rent homes to prospective residents while delivering outstanding customer service.

  • Set and achieve monthly sales goals, retention targets, and occupancy goals as defined by Bridge Homes management.

  • Actively monitor vacancy rates and prioritize efforts to minimize marketing downtime.

  • Assist in rental rate and concession setting for the market.

  • Complete Comparative Market Analyses (CMAs) as needed.

  • Review and create property descriptions and implement marketing strategies to promote available homes.

  • Partner with the Senior Property Manager to support resident retention efforts, including follow-ups, renewals, move-in checklists, and tenant communication.

  • Assist in collecting supporting documents and processing applications.

  • Conduct daily prospect follow-ups and input feedback into Rently.

  • Collaborate with Property Managers and Maintenance teams on monthly rent-ready inspections.

  • Provide a high level of customer service during move-in orientations and renewal inspections.

  • Follow Bridge Homes policies and procedures and ensure compliance with Fair Housing, state, and federal laws.

  • Perform other duties and special projects as assigned.

What You Should Bring

  • Proven sales or leasing experience, with strong knowledge of closing techniques and customer service best practices.

  • Ability to consistently achieve or exceed leasing goals and occupancy targets.

  • Excellent commun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ills.

  • Strong attention to detail and ability to manage multiple priorities effectively.

  • Proficiency in CRM systems or property management platforms (such as Rently).

  • Knowledge of Fair Housing regulations and compliance standards.

  • Ability to work both independently and collaboratively with cross-functional teams.

  • Flexibility to work in a hybrid environment, with up to four days per week in the office as required.

What we offer

  • Full Insurance benefit suite including Medical Insurance, Dental Insurance, Vision Insurance, Critical Illness Insurance, Accident Insurance, Short Term Disability, Legal & Identity Theft Insurance, and Pet Insurance.
  • Company paid Life Insurance (option to buy additional available) and Long-Term Disability.
  • Access to benefits concierge service.
  • Access to Mental Health & Well-Being service.
  • 401K:Bridge Investment Group will match your contributions dollar-for-dollar, up to 6% of your pay. These contributions are fully vested immediately. Eligible employees are automatically enrolled at a 4% contribution rate. *The employee must be at least 21 years of age and have worked for the Company for at least 60 days.
  • Paid Time Off: Employee will accrue 5.23 hours of paid time off per pay period for a total of 17 days per year.
  • 11 Paid Holidays per year.
  • Following six (6) months of employment at the Company, you will be eligible per birth, adoption or placement of a child for four (4) weeks of paid parental leave as the primary caregiver to the child or two weeks of paid parental leave as the secondary caregiver to the child. Following two years of employment at the Company, you will be eligible for twelve weeks of paid parental leave per birth, adoption, or placement of a child if you are the primary caregiver of the child.
  • Tuition Reimbursement: Up to $5,000 per year of pre-approved tuition expenses will be reimbursed upon submission of approved documentation. Repayment obligations may apply if employment terminates prior to 24 months.
